Date: April 22, 2001
Location: Toppenish National Wildlife Refuge, Yakima County, Washington


Beautiful spring morning at the refuge. Birds were observed from the
observation platform, along the nature trail, and around the Refuge
Headquarters unless noted otherwise.

Birds seen (in taxonomic order):
